The Cub
Scout Pack
Your boy is a
member of a den. A den consists of 6 to 10 boys of the same grade
level who meet once a week. A den leader (a Scout’s parent) is in charge
of activities, including games, crafts, songs and lots of fun.
Your boy is a member of a pack.
A pack consists of several dens and meets once a month. The Cubmaster
leads pack meetings, with Cub Scouts and their families in attendance.
The pack meeting includes fun activities, as well as the presentation of
awards that have been earned that month.
The pack is run by the pack
committee. The pack committee is a group of adults (usually parents
of boys in the pack) appointed by the chartered organization to
administer the pack’s program.
Tiger Cubs - 1st
grade
Tiger Cubs is a fun program that
introduces first grade boys and their adult partners to the excitement
of Cub Scouts as they "search, discover, and share" together.

Cub Scouts - 2nd and 3rd
grades
Cub Scouts are boys in second and
third grades. Second grade boys work to earn their Wolf badge. Third
grade boys work to earn their Bear badge.
Webelos - 4th and 5th
grades
Webelos stands for "WE’ll
BE LOyal Scouts", is a for fourth and fifth grade
boys. Boys work on requirements for the Webelos badge and Arrow of Light
(the highest rank in Cub Scouting). Camping, sports and outdoor
activities are important parts of the Webelos program.
